News
Tension Leg Platforms (TLPs) are a type of floating offshore structure that are anchored to the seabed using tethers held in ...
4 June 2025 AI assistant Humphrey uses models from companies facing major copyright lawsuits | Concerns rise over ...
4 June 2025 AI assistant Humphrey uses models from companies facing major copyright lawsuits | Concerns rise over ...
Hearing concludes in wireless tech case concerning portable chargers | Recent parallel proceedings saw Belkin hit with 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results